Ten minutes a day, four simple steps
Hear it
Every word is spoken in a real sentence with synonyms, so it has meaning — not just letters.
See it flash
The word flashes up to 11 times. The brain learns to recognize whole words instantly — that’s fluency.
Write it
Your child writes the word from memory and is checked on the spot, moving it into long-term memory.
Play it
Quick games lock the set in. Ten minutes a day is the whole lesson.
